You should always pronounce ㄷ as ㄷ. The Latin letters d and t and the matching English sounds do not reflect Korean pronunciation. Don't worry about Romanization or thinking about things in English. They are two very different languages with very different sounds. SOUND CHANGES ASSOCIATED WITH ㄷ : When ㅎ follows it, it will sound like ㅌ. ("Like t") When ㄷ is 받침, it will sound like ㄸ. ("Like d") Any other time, ㄷ is a unique sound not able to be expressed by d or t.
